2024 Fantasy Outlook
After being selected in the third round of the 2023 draft, Pickens was a rotational player who was on the field for 251 snaps in 17 games. On the season, the defensive tackle recorded 20 tackles and a forced fumble. If his snap share increases, he could emerge as a solid interior lineman in IDP leagues. Read Past Outlooks

Pickens (groin) is questionable to return to Sunday's contest against the Texans.
ANALYSIS
Pickens appears to have picked up a groin injury against Houston and his status for the rest of the game is now up in the air. In his absence, Chris Williams could see an increase in his workload at defensive tackle.

2023 Fantasy Outlook
The Bears selected Pickens with the 64th pick in the 2023 draft, so they made a solid investment in addressing their interior defensive line. In past years, Chicago struggled with interior defense, both in terms of stopping the run and pressuring opposing quarterbacks. In the short term, Pickens may find himself competing with free-agent addition Andrew Billings, who is a six year veteran. However, if Pickens lives up to his draft capital early on, he could take the lead in what will likely be a defensive line rotation.
